The key to stimulating exports is increasing the number of exporters, right now only 15 percent of Romanian firms in the field having domestic capital, according to Costin Borc, Minister of the Economy, as cited by Agerpres. “If we want to increase export, we have to grow those enterprises that can make exports, those enterprises that can compete on the single market,” said Borc.
Moreover, “we are 53rd worldwide in terms of exports and 17th in the European Union. Exports represent 30 percent of GDP,” he further added. The Minister also pointed out that of the 750,000 enterprises registered with the Trade Registry, 22,000 are exporters.
With 85 percent of Romanian exporting companies being local branches of foreign groups, “only 15 percent of exporters are enterprises with Romanian capital. There are only 50 companies with Romanian capital that have a turnover of over EUR 100 million. The key to enhancing exports is increasing the number of exporters,” added Borc.
